Abstract
This chapter is devoted to the study of timed weighted event graphs, which constitute a subclass of Petri nets often considered for modeling embedded applications such as video encoders. Some basic recent mathemat- ical properties are presented, leading to algorithms checking the liveness and computing the optimum throughput of these systems.
